Replacing Double Glazed Glass Only Near Me
Replacing double-glazed glass is costly especially if you have to replace the entire window. However, if the frame of your window is in good shape it is not necessary to replace the entire window. The cost of replacing a double-pane window using gas argon in between two panes is $200 to $600 on average.

Double pane windows, also called Insulated glass units (IGUs) comprise of two glass panes separated by a spacer, and sometimes, a layer of air for insulation. These windows are common in most homes and are an excellent option for energy efficiency. However, they may fail due to poor seals around the frames and the glass. In these instances, condensation may build up between the glass panes. This can lead to the energy efficiency of the building being reduced.
It could be time to replace the entire frame if your window is leaking. This is more expensive than simply repairing the glass, but it's worth it to keep your home warm and dry. However, if the window is still covered by warranty, you should call the manufacturer first to avoid voiding the warranty.

The cheapest replacement window is one-pane flat or floating glass. This kind of window is typically found in older homes with aluminum frames. It is also the least efficient. Newer homes generally have double-pane or insulated units. The space between the two panes of glass is filled with argon to provide insulation.
Tempered glass can be used to replace double-paned or insulation units. It is four times stronger than untreated glass. It also meets safety standards. Tempered glass breaks into round cubes, which reduces the chance of injuries. Replacement windows are priced between $180 and $700, based on their size and type.

Double-pane windows are made up of two glass panes, separated from one another by a gap, which can be filled with insulation gas, such as argon. The argon gas provides an airtight seal to keep out cold and heat. Double-pane windows tend to be more expensive than single-pane windows however, the cost is offset by their energy efficiency. A damaged window is a sign that the airtight seal has broken, which could cause the condensation of moisture to freeze in cold weather. Moisture can cause condensation between window panes, which could make your home uncomfortable and increase your utility bill.
